你查询的IP:[121.4.112.161]  地理位置:中国–上海–上海

最新查询59.107.178.207 222.240.183.4 58.192.234.177 221.200.244.143 203.90.136.195 221.196.211.7 125.169.74.14 121.55.132.190 116.128.193.209 121.4.112.161 222.160.123.71 121.79.128.4 121.51.13.135 202.122.128.86 210.52.56.23 202.4.128.20 124.88.146.17 60.232.41.72 221.108.129.143 125.62.27.141 220.101.192.97 222.128.150.23 203.90.192.229 116.204.187.83 121.101.208.115 119.27.192.64 119.96.160.130 116.224.147.198 121.55.59.115 202.127.216.198 120.30.92.166